M-G-M actress, Cyd Charisse, likes her clothes cut on simple lines. One of her favourites is this frock of sheer grey wool which features a set-in sleeve with raglan effect, end is adorned with a bright red leather belt and an unusual fob. Miss Charisse, who was a member of the Ballet Russe before she broke into lms, likes to combine dancing with straight dramatic roles in her films, This she does in two of her most recent assignments, "Fiesta" and "The Unfinished Dance," both Technicolor productions.
